Sorel works in sculpture, printmaking, and watercolour, and also makes and publishes artists' books. She has had more than 20 solo shows in the UK, Canada, Israel, the USA and Germany, including a major retrospective at Bradfords Cartwright Hall in 2004. Her work explores the use of line in both print and sculpture and also examines notions of perspective using a variety of media. Agathe Sorel says of her practice, 'My work comprises several media, and I move frequently from one to another. Painting, sculpture, printmaking, livres d’artiste are the main areas, but on a practical level also includes photography and digital work. I always tried to disregard artificial barriers between these territories.'
